NFL Cuts 2011: Denver Broncos Cut CB Perrish Cox

The Denver Broncos, it turned out, did cut cornerback Perrish Cox on Saturday in order to reach the 53-man roster limit. Cox had an uninspiring preseason and his legal troubles were always hanging over him. Cox is alleged to have sexually assaulted a woman and gotten her pregnant.

Cox, it was believed, had a better chance making the roster once fellow second-year cornerback Syd'Quan Thompson was lost for the season with a torn Achilles tendon. However, it appears that Cox's dismal performance on Thursday against the Arizona Cardinals made the decision for John Fox.

The Broncos will now likely cut their roster to below the 53-man limit so that they can pick up a cornerback who is cut from another team. The Broncos' final roster might not be set for a few days, but for now we'll wait to see who else is cut to reach the limit.
